Key Differences

In short, we have a clear winner — GeForce RTX 4060 outperforms the more expensive Radeon Pro W5500 on the selected game parameters, and is also a better bang for your buck! The better performing GeForce RTX 4060 is 1193 days newer than the more expensive Radeon Pro W5500.

Advantages of N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4060

  • Performs up to 46% better in Deathloop than Radeon Pro W5500 - 99 vs 68 FPS
  • Up to 11% cheaper than Radeon Pro W5500 - £289.0 vs £326.06
  • Up to 39% better value when playing Deathloop than Radeon Pro W5500 - £2.92 vs £4.79 per FPS
  • Consumes up to 8% less energy than AMD Radeon Pro W5500 - 115 vs 125 Watts
